About Barangay Santo Niño

Barangay Santo Niño forms part of Dinalupihan, a municipality in Bataan, and is classified as a mid-sized barangay.

According to the 2020 Census of Population and Housing conducted by the Philippine Statistics Authority, Barangay Santo Niño had a population of 3,478. This made it the 14th largest of 46 barangays in Dinalupihan by population, placing it in the upper half of the municipality. Residents of Barangay Santo Niño accounted for approximately 2.94% of the total population of Dinalupihan, which stood at 118,209 in the same census year.

The barangay recorded 3,190 residents in the 2015 intercensal count and 3,478 residents in the 2020 Census — a net change of +9.0%, consistent with a growing settlement. The Philippine Statistics Authority classifies Barangay Santo Niño as rural, a designation applied to barangays with lower population density and predominantly non-built-up land use.

Dinalupihan is a municipality comprising 46 barangays, and serves as the governing unit directly responsible for local services in Barangay Santo Niño, including public health, sanitation, peace and order, and civil registration. Within the wider province of Bataan, which contains 237 barangays across its component cities and municipalities, Barangay Santo Niño ranks 85th by 2020 population. Bataan is classified as a 1st by the Bureau of Local Government Finance, a category that reflects the province's annual regular income.

Like every Philippine barangay, Barangay Santo Niño is led by an elected Punong Barangay (barangay captain) supported by seven Sangguniang Barangay members (kagawads), an SK Chairperson, a Barangay Secretary, and a Barangay Treasurer. The next Barangay and Sangguniang Kabataan Elections (BSKE) are scheduled for Monday, November 2, 2026, with officials serving four-year terms under Republic Act No. 12232.
